The National Competitive Music Festival
Programme for the National Competitive Music Festival organised as part of the Festival of Britain, 1951. This event was arranged by the British Federation of Music Festivals, and included a choral competition. The composer, Vaughan Williams, president of the Federation, composed three new songs as test pieces for the competition. These were first performed at the Royal Festival Hall on 23 June 1951.
